Sample project using ezored to build a SDL2 application.
- macos
- linux
- windows
Obs: Generally any platform with C++ support will work too, like smart tvs and embeded hardwares.
- Check ezored project for general requirements.
- Add bincrafters conan server:
conan remote add bincrafters https://api.bintray.com/conan/bincrafters/public-conan
- sudo apt-get install libudev-dev
- sudo apt-get install libusb-dev
- sudo apt-get install libusb-1.0-0-dev
-
Clone reposity:
git clone git@github.com:ezored/ezored-sdl2.git
-
Enter on cloned folder:
cd ezored-sdl2
-
The other commands is the same of any ezored project:
https://github.com/ezored/ezored
The folder containing all prebuilt things (windows, macos, linux and others) are not versioned, but you can download a full version with the following command:
python make.py dist download
This command will download the following file:
And will unpack for you creating a folder called "dist" with all prebuilt files in the project root folder.
You can also pack "dist" folder again using:
python make.py dist pack
Copyright (c) 2019-present, Paulo Coutinho